/****************************************************************************
* Included Files
****************************************************************************/
#include <nuttx/config.h>
#include <stdint.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<errno.h>
#include <netinet/in.h>
#include <nuttx/net/ip.h>
#include "devif/devif.h"
#include "route/cacheroute.h"
#include "route/route.h"
#if defined(CONFIG_NET) && defined(CONFIG_NET_ROUTE)
/****************************************************************************
* Pre-processor Definitions
****************************************************************************/
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v6_CACHEROUTE
# define IPv4_ROUTER entry.router
#else
# define IPv4_ROUTER router
#endif
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v6_CACHEROUTE
# define IPv6_ROUTER entry.router
#else
# define IPv6_ROUTER router
#endif
/****************************************************************************
* Private Types
****************************************************************************/
#ifdef CONFIG_NET_IPv4
struct route_ipv4_match_s
{
in_addr_t target; /* Target IPv4 address on remote network */
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v4_CACHEROUTE
struct net_route_ipv4_s entry; /* Full entry from the IPv4 routing table */
#else
in_addr_t router; /* IPv4 address of router a local networks */
#endif
};
#endif
#ifdef CONFIG_NET_IPv6
struct route_ipv6_match_s
{
net_ipv6addr_t target; /* Target IPv6 address on remote network */
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v6_CACHEROUTE
struct net_route_ipv6_s entry; /* Full entry from the IPv6 routing table */
#else
net_ipv6addr_t router; /* IPv6 address of router a local networks */
#endif
};
#endif
/****************************************************************************
* Private Functions
****************************************************************************/
/****************************************************************************
* Name: net_ipv4_match
*
* Description:
* Return 1 if the IPv4 route is available
*
* Input Parameters:
* route - The next route to examine
* arg - The match values (cast to void*)
*
* Returned Value:
* 0 if the entry is not a match; 1 if the entry matched and was cleared.
*
****************************************************************************/
#ifdef CONFIG_NET_IPv4
static int net_ipv4_match(FAR struct net_route_ipv4_s *route, FAR void *arg)
{
FAR struct route_ipv4_match_s *match = (FAR struct route_ipv4_match_s *)arg;
/* To match, the masked target addresses must be the same. In the event
* of multiple matches, only the first is returned. There is not (yet) any
* concept for the precedence of networks.
*/
if (net_ipv4addr_maskcmp(route->target, match->target, route->netmask))
{
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v4_CACHEROUTE
/* They match.. Copy the entire routing table entry */
memcpy(&match->entry, route, sizeof(struct net_route_ipv4_s));
#else
/* They match.. Copy the router address */
net_ipv4addr_copy(match->router, route->router);
#endif
return 1;
}
return 0;
}
#endif /* CONFIG_NET_IPv4 */
/****************************************************************************
* Name: net_ipv6_match
*
* Description:
* Return 1 if the IPv6 route is available
*
* Input Parameters:
* route - The next route to examine
* arg - The match values (cast to void*)
*
* Returned Value:
* 0 if the entry is not a match; 1 if the entry matched and was cleared.
*
****************************************************************************/
#ifdef CONFIG_NET_IPv6
static int net_ipv6_match(FAR struct net_route_ipv6_s *route, FAR void *arg)
{
FAR struct route_ipv6_match_s *match = (FAR struct route_ipv6_match_s *)arg;
/* To match, the masked target addresses must be the same. In the event
* of multiple matches, only the first is returned. There is not (yet) any
* concept for the precedence of networks.
*/
if (net_ipv6addr_maskcmp(route->target, match->target, route->netmask))
{
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v6_CACHEROUTE
/* They match.. Copy the entire routing table entry */
memcpy(&match->entry, route, sizeof(struct net_route_ipv6_s));
#else
/* They match.. Copy the router address */
net_ipv6addr_copy(match->router, route->router);
#endif
return 1;
}
return 0;
}
#endif /* CONFIG_NET_IPv6 */
/****************************************************************************
* Public Functions
****************************************************************************/
/****************************************************************************
* Name: net_ipv4_router
*
* Description:
* Given an IPv4 address on a external network, return the address of the
* router on a local network that can forward to the external network.
*
* Input Parameters:
* target - An IPv4 address on a remote network to use in the lookup.
* router - The address of router on a local network that can forward our
* packets to the target.
*
* Returned Value:
* OK on success; Negated errno on failure.
*
****************************************************************************/
#ifdef CONFIG_NET_IPv4
int net_ipv4_router(in_addr_t target, FAR in_addr_t *router)
{
struct route_ipv4_match_s match;
int ret;
/* Do not route the special broadcast IP address */
if (net_ipv4addr_cmp(target, INADDR_BROADCAST))
{
return -ENOENT;
}
/* Set up the comparison structure */
memset(&match, 0, sizeof(struct route_ipv4_match_s));
net_ipv4addr_copy(match.target, target);
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v4_CACHEROUTE
/* First see if we can find a router entry in the cache */
ret = net_foreachcache_ipv4(net_ipv4_match, &match);
if (ret <= 0)
#endif
{
/* Not found in the cache. Try to find a router entry with the
* routing table that can forward to this address
*/
ret = net_foreachroute_ipv4(net_ipv4_match, &match);
}
/* Did we find a route? */
if (ret <= 0)
{
/* No.. there is no route for this address */
return -ENOENT;
}
/* We found a route. */
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v4_CACHEROUTE
/* Add the route to the cache. If the route is already in the cache, this
* will update it to the most recently accessed.
*/
net_addcache_ipv4(&match.entry);
#endif
/* Return the router address. */
net_ipv4addr_copy(*router, match.IPv4_ROUTER);
return OK;
}
#endif /* CONFIG_NET_IPv4 */
/****************************************************************************
* Name: net_ipv6_router
*
* Description:
* Given an IPv6 address on a external network, return the address of the
* router on a local network that can forward to the external network.
*
* Input Parameters:
* target - An IPv6 address on a remote network to use in the lookup.
* router - The address of router on a local network that can forward our
* packets to the target.
*
* Returned Value:
* OK on success; Negated errno on failure.
*
****************************************************************************/
#ifdef CONFIG_NET_IPv6
int net_ipv6_router(const net_ipv6addr_t target, net_ipv6addr_t router)
{
struct route_ipv6_match_s match;
int ret;
/* Do not route to any the special IPv6 multicast addresses */
if (target[0] == HTONS(0xff02))
{
return -ENOENT;
}
/* Set up the comparison structure */
memset(&match, 0, sizeof(struct route_ipv6_match_s));
net_ipv6addr_copy(match.target, target);
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v6_CACHEROUTE
/* First see if we can find a router entry in the cache */
ret = net_foreachcache_ipv6(net_ipv6_match, &match);
if (ret <= 0)
#endif
{
/* Not found in the cache. Try to find a router entry with the
* routing table that can forward to this address
*/
ret = net_foreachroute_ipv6(net_ipv6_match, &match);
}
/* Did we find a route? */
if (ret <= 0)
{
/* No.. there is no route for this address */
return -ENOENT;
}
/* We found a route. */
#ifdef CONFIG_ROUTE_IPv6_CACHEROUTE
/* Add the route to the cache. If the route is already in the cache, this
* will update it to the most recently accessed.
*/
net_addcache_ipv6(&match.entry);
#endif
/* Return the router address. */
net_ipv6addr_copy(router, match.IPv6_ROUTER);
return OK;
}
#endif /* CONFIG_NET_IPv6 */
